This Position reports to: R&D Leader – Grid Components
The work model for the role is: Hybrid in Mebane, NC
Accountabilities
Overseeing all phases of Outdoor power grid components project lifecycle, from planning to execution, ensuring delivery on time, within scope, and on budget.
Managing project financials, including budget tracking, cost control, and forecasting to ensure profitability and fiscal responsibility.
Developing and maintaining detailed project schedules, identifying key milestones and ensuring adherence to timelines.
Leading cross‑functional teams, fostering collaboration and resolving conflicts to ensure high‑performance outcomes.
Implementing risk management strategies to mitigate issues impacting project quality, cost, or timeline.
Driving successful execution of complex, large‑scale projects with multiple stakeholders, ensuring client satisfaction.
Tracking project progress, generating regular reports, and communicating key updates to senior leadership and stakeholders.
Qualifications
University degree in Engineering, preferably in Electrical Engineering.
PMP certification is a plus.
Minimum of 10 years of experience in the power/energy engineering industry, with at least 5 years in project management roles.
20% travel expected.

Benefit Summary [excludes ABB E‑mobility, Athens union, Puerto Rico]
Go to myBenefitsABB.com and click on “Candidate/Guest” to learn more.
Choice between two medical plan options: A PPO plan called the Copay Plan OR a High Deductible Health Plan (with a Health Savings Account) called the High Deductible Plan.
Choice between two dental plan options: Core and Core Plus
Vision benefit
Company paid life insurance (2X base pay)
Company paid AD&D (1X base pay)
Voluntary life and AD&D – 100% employee paid up to maximums
Short Term Disability – up to 26 weeks – Company paid
Long Term Disability – 60% of pay – Company paid. Ability to “buy‑up” to 66 2/3% of pay.
Supplemental benefits – 100% employee paid (Accident insurance, hospital indemnity, critical illness, pet insurance)
Parental Leave – up to 6 weeks
Employee Assistance Program
Health Advocate support resources for mental/behavioral health, general health navigation and virtual health, and infertility/adoption
Employee discount program
Retirement
401k Savings Plan with Company Contributions
Employee Stock Acquisition Plan (ESAP)
Time Off
ABB provides 11 paid holidays.
Salaried exempt positions are provided vacation under a permissive time away policy.
While base salary is determined by things such as the successful applicant’s qualifications and experience, this position is expected to pay between $98,700 and $157,920 annually and is eligible for a short‑term incentive plan/annual bonus.
